The Graduate Education Program provides resources and instructional materials to meet the needs of far flung instructors and students. Roger K. Summit Scholarship The Roger K. Summit Scholarship is a global award presented annually by Dialog. The scholarship was established to honor Dr. Roger K. Summit, the founder of Dialog, for his outstanding contributions to the field of information science. The $5000 award is made to a graduate student in library or information science who has demonstrated outstanding interest or performance in electronic information services. There are three separate awards presented: the Americas, Europe, and Asia-Pacific. For more information, please contact the scholarship representative for your region.
